Hello all,

 

I'm trying to find some software that will make my meal planning easier, & I was

hoping some of you might have recommendations. I

need something that will allow me to:

 

input, save & print recipes

produce a number of mealplans using the recipes

produce grocery lists using the mealplans

 

Nice-but-not-essential features would be:

 

nutritional value calculations

able to size up/size down recipes

 

I've looked at MasterCook on-line but want something that will allow me to save

a larger number of mealplans & shopping lists. I've

also tried three downloaded software packages, but am not sold on any of them. I

have tried Recipe Library, which was just hopeless,

then I tried Now You're Cooking - I don't particularly find this easy to use, &

it seems that you have to add new ingredient items

to the list of recipe ingredients & then separately to the list of items in the

grocery store aisle list, which is a pain. I've also

tried Easy Recipe Deluxe - I find this much easier to navigate round, but it

doesn't allow changes to the format of either the

grocery list or the recipe card, & I can't figure out how to assign a particular

store & aisle to an ingredient so it will

automatically pick up that info when making a grocery list. I think there may be

some bugs in the software too, as I'm also finding

it does some peculiar things when it processes the ingredients in the list - a

can of beans will suddenly become 1 tbsp, for

example, or 4 potatoes will become 4 tsp potatoes! Also I've found that

sometimes the help files are available, & sometimes they

just won't appear at all.

 

So the hunt continues...can anyone help?
